I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

SAP Crystal Reports Discussion :

Appel à une DLL externe (u2ltext.dll de Sage X3) depuis un programme externe à Crystal


Sujet :

SAP Crystal Reports

  1. #1
    Membre actif Avatar de Cereal123
    Homme Profil pro
    Responsable de service informatique
    Inscrit en
    Juin 2004
    Messages
    414
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France

    Informations professionnelles :
    Activité : Responsable de service informatique

    Informations forums :
    Inscription : Juin 2004
    Messages : 414
    Points : 214
    Points
    214
    Par défaut Appel à une DLL externe (u2ltext.dll de Sage X3) depuis un programme externe à Crystal
    Bonjour,

    J'ai développé un programme en VB.net qui utilise certains rapports Crystal Reports de notre ERP Sage X3.

    Tout se passe bien, sauf quand le rapport utilise la fonction X3TranslatedText()
    Dans ce cas, une erreur survient à l'affichage du rapport depuis le programme VB.net : la fonction X3TranslatedText est inconnue.

    Cette fonction est ajoutée à Crystal via la DLL u2Ltext.dll fournie par SAGE. J'ai donc essayé :

    - de l'enregistrer dans la base de registre via la commande :

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
     
    regsvr32 /i C:\Windows\Crystal\U2ltext.dll
    ... mais Windows dit que ce n'est pas possible car il ne trouve pas ses entrées.

    - d'ajouter une référence à cette DLL directement dans mon projet VB.net, mais Visual Studio me dit que la DLL n'est pas conforme.

    --> Comment faire ?
    Merci de votre aide.

    C.

  2. #2
    Membre régulier
    Profil pro
    Inscrit en
    Juillet 2005
    Messages
    161
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Juillet 2005
    Messages : 161
    Points : 77
    Points
    77
    Par défaut
    Pour information, depuis ce matin mon antivirus d'entreprise "WithSecure" considère u2ltext.dll comme un virus...
    Du coup mise en quarantaine automatique et impossibilité d'imprimer sous Sage X3 V6 pour tous mes utilisateurs...

    Joie & Bonheur.

    J'ai pu créer une règle de non contrôle sur la centrale d'administration de l'antivirus et j'ai restauré le fichier sur les postes où il manquait, mais je me serai bien passé de tout ça.

    D'autres ont connu les mêmes mésaventures ?

Discussions similaires

  1. Réponses: 3
    Dernier message: 23/07/2011, 07h55
  2. Problème d'appel à une fonction de Shell32.dll sous win server 2008
    Par ludogoal dans le forum API, COM et SDKs
    Réponses: 6
    Dernier message: 05/06/2009, 15h06
  3. Réponses: 12
    Dernier message: 12/05/2006, 09h21
  4. [DLL] problème pour appeler une fonction d'une DLL
    Par bigboomshakala dans le forum MFC
    Réponses: 34
    Dernier message: 19/07/2004, 11h30
  5. Appeler une API sans liaison avec une DLL
    Par mat.M dans le forum x86 32-bits / 64-bits
    Réponses: 10
    Dernier message: 13/07/2004, 02h22

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o